They are different vehicles, much in the same way an LR4 is different from a Defender. The G-Wagon is a heavy, overbuilt military vehicle that has been lightly adapted to commercial and civilian use. It is better than an LR4 or MKIII in some ways and not as good in others. Having done remote, solo travel in Africa with G-Wagons, I appreciate its strengths. It is a world-class exploration platform.

What substantial differences do you think there are between the pimp my ride vs stripped out version, in terms of capability?

We get the more problematic V8 and the numerous secondary and tertiary systems no one needs, i.e heated bull****, navigation, 35 different airbags, chrome badging, "special paint", 19" "special" wheels, suede headliner, etc etc.

It's such a delicious, hideous irony that the country with the greatest access to cheap fuel gets the least robust version of every 4x4 available.

Not sure i agree. I came close to buying a used G500 earlier this year. Didn't find it to have much of anything extra that would be different from any modern car. Sure, it may have a heated seats and could have lots of custom stuff but only if you buy that option package. And lots of airbags are a must for me if I buy something new. After all, you are only going to get a chance to die of a car accident on the way to the trailhead. I want those airbags.

Stripper trucks are great but as someone who learned to drive in a LR Series II 109, owns a stripper FJ60 and Gen 2 4Runner (both since new), I really appreciate the modern touches that add up to a much safer vehicle.

I ended up not buying anything new. I decided my FJ100 was good enough for now. Oh yeah, it is a 98 - the stripper version.
